River Region's AIDS Outreach Unit has been serving the Jacksonville area for over ten years, providing extensive services within the community. The Outreach Unit offers Confidential HIV Antibody Testing, Counseling before and after testing, Risk Assessment/Risk Reductions, TB Screening & Testing, Substance Abuse Referrals, and other related services. Testing is free and all services are confidential.

St.John'sHorizonHouse is Northeast Florida/Southeast Georgia's largest and most comprehensive supportive housing program for people living with HIV/AIDS. The community includes persons at all points in the HIV-disease progression.

Supportive Housing Program: Residents are provided an array of housing and supportive services in a caring home-like environment. Residents are low-income persons with HIV/AIDS who are homeless or lack a reliable 24 hour caregiver.
